GUIDELINES FOR AN ENJOYABLE STAYPETS ARE WELCOME: However they MUST be kept on a leash when outside of your RV. Animals must be attended at all times. Please note the DOG WALK AREAS on the Resort Map. You are required to pick up after your pet including in the horse area. Pet Rules are strictly enforced up to and including the loss of your deposit for failure to observe this rule. In the event that the Resort has to clean up after your pet or your site of pet waste, you will be charged a $50 clean-up fee. Guests are responsible for any damage or injuries caused by their pets. Verification of rabies and parvo shots are required of all pets, including your visitors’ pets.
VISITORS: All incoming visitors must check in at the office before entering the Resort.
CHILDREN: Children are always welcome at Horspitality RV Resort. It should be noted that the Resort is primarily an adult park from October to April. Parents must exercise extreme caution and must keep a close eye on their children’s activities. Horses, ATVs and the mere fact that the Resort is virtually full during that time makes being watchful a must. Children are not permitted to operate ANY wheeled vehicle in the Resort. That includes skateboards, bicycles, tricycles, ATVs or any other vehicle. Dirt Bikes are never permitted at Horspitality. Dirt Bikes must remain on trailers or holders while in the Resort.
HORSE CORRAL AREA: You enter the Horse Area at your own risk. Children are never allowed in the horse area. DO NOT go near a horse unless the owner is present and permits you to do so.
EQUINE ACTIVITIES: Per Arizona Law, an equine activities sponsor or equine owner’s agent is not liable for an injury to or the death of a participant in equine activities resulting from the inherent risk of equine activities pursuant to A.R.S. 12-553.
SPEED LIMITS: No vehicle may exceed the posted speed limit of 10 MPH. This includes bicycles, ATVs, golf carts, cars and trucks and all other vehicles, motorized and non-motorized.
OUTSIDE STORAGE: All outside storage is prohibited. Storage under RVs is not allowed. You may have patio furniture and grills on your patio, but all other items must be stored IN your RV and out of sight. You may store items behind an approved skirt.
NO OPEN FIRES: The desert has a constant danger of fire. Only enclosed, supervised fires are permitted. Chimineas, portable outside fireplaces, gas grills and charcoal grills are permitted at RV sites. Ground fires are NEVER permitted at any RV site. Resort approved bonfires are held with prior approval. Charcoal may never be dumped on the ground even when cool. A can marked “Charcoal” is located near the bonfire area for charcoal disposal.
THROWING OF ANY ITEM IS NOT PERMITTED. This includes balls of any type, Frisbees, boomerangs, jarts, darts, etc. If you would like to play a game requiring the throwing of items, please see the office for an approved area.
SECURITY: YOU are responsible for the security of your property. Horspitality does not guarantee the security of your property. We recommend you lock or otherwise secure all personal property just as you would in any other public place.
STORAGE: If you choose to use the Horspitality Storage Facility you are responsible for carrying insurance on your possessions. Horspitality does not insure your property. We further recommend you secure all removable items such as batteries, propane tanks and any other exterior items. Needless to say, you should always lock your unit. Losses incurred while stored at Horspitality are the responsibility of the stored item’s owner, not Horspitality.
SITE CLEANUP: Please leave your site in the condition you find it. We will inspect your site after you remove your RV, and if we find that it requires cleaning we will charge you a $50.00 cleaning fee. This includes picking up pet waste, repairing pet holes or damage or removal of any items not belonging in the site.

FLOOD PLAIN: The Horse Area is partially located in a flood plain. In the past 20 years river water has entered the area a few times. We do our best to minimize the effects.
Though past losses have been miniscule, it is your responsibility to take appropriate measures to insure and safeguard your property. For more information, ask Paul or Janice.

DEPOSITS, PREPAYMENTS AND REFUNDS• DEPOSITS: The purpose of deposits is to guarantee a site for a specific date or dates. If you
cancel your reservation prior to arrival, you forfeit your deposit and it will not be returned to you. We do not guarantee a reservation until we receive the deposit.
• DEPOSITS AFTER ARRIVAL: Your deposit will not be refunded to you until you complete your entire stay. Deposits will not be applied toward any other rental or expense in the Resort except for your last electric or propane bill. It will be refunded at the completion of your stay by mail after we deduct any outstanding bills such as electric and propane. If you leave before the dates you initialed on your registration form, you will lose your deposit and you will still be responsible for any outstanding bills up to and including the remainder of the stay you agreed to and initialed on your registration form. If you have prepaid your entire stay, you WILL be refunded your deposit after deducting outstanding bills even if you leave early.
• PREPAYMENTS: We do not refund prepayments. If you prepay your stay for any reason and then decide to leave early or are asked to leave for cause, we will not refund your prepayment or deposit. You are still required to pay any outstanding bills such as electric or propane. This applies to weekly, monthly, seasonal and annual prepayments.
• REFUNDS: In the event Horspitality finds it necessary to cancel your reservation, we will refund your deposit. We do reserve the right to cancel any reservation for any reason.
• USE OF RENTAL SITE: If you choose to leave prior to the departure date on your registration form, you forfeit the use of the site. Horspitality will use the site upon your departure. The purpose of the site is to be used as an RV Site and is not to be used to store any items not normally associated with camping. You may leave your RV on site until the end of the period on your registration form. If you remove your RV you must remove all other items. The exception is for those who leave for a short trip to another area with the intent to return. This trip is limited to one week unless approved by Horspitality prior to leaving. If you remove your RV and leave other items behind without approval, we will remove them from the site and will assume they have been abandoned.

ARIZONA FLAGThe 13 rays of red and gold on the top half of the flag represent both the 13 original colonies of the Union and the rays of the western setting sun. Red and gold werealso the colors carried by Coronado’s Spanish expedition, in search of the Seven Cities of Cibola in 1540. The bottom half of the flag has the same Liberty blue as the United States flag. Since Arizona was the largest producer of copper in the nation, a copper star was placed in the flag’s center. The flag was adopted in 1917.
